Quiescent solar conditions have returned since the last message, with
solar X-ray flux remaining steady around the B1 level. NOAA 12894 has
decayed significantly and now comprises a solitary alpha spot. It
shall remain the target region for a further 24 hour although only
minor activity is expected at this time.

The position of NOAA 12894 on 14-Nov-2021 at 12:30 UT is:

S28W40, ( 551", -489" )
